"The Brazilian Top Team’s Paulo Filho extended his unbeaten streak to 11 fights, winning a somewhat uneventful, but clear, unanimous decision win over Murilo “Ninja” Rua in the Chute Boxe fighter’s welterweight debut. Filho used excellent takedowns and world-class ground control to dominate the action."
